Earlier, we mentioned how CBD oil comes in various bottle sizes that contain different concentrations of CBD. The key thing to consider is the milligram of CBD per serving.

It will tell you how powerful that particular CBD oil is. The CBD oil dosage chart above is an excellent guide to figuring out what strength of CBD oil you could start with. While both bottles contain the same total amount of cannabinoids (1000 mg), the bottles have two different strengths. In percentage terms, the 10ml bottle of CBD oil contains 10% CBD and the 20ml bottle has 5% CBD, which means you will have half the amount of CBD per drop.

The most common dose of CBD is 20 to 40 mg per dose. Some people take much less (as low as 1 mg), others take much more (up to 100 mg). First of all, strength is important from the point of view of effectiveness. The stronger a CBD oil is, the greater its potency and the more effects it produces.

So what counts as a strong CBD oil? In Rae's view, the limit for a “high-potency CBD oil” is 35 milligrams per serving. Anything below that, and consumers are likely to have immeasurable blood levels of CBD. According to Adie Rae, a cannabis researcher at Legacy Health, a high-potency CBD oil requires at least 35 milligrams per serving. Similarly, if your goal is to use high-strength CBD, buying a low-potency CBD oil (300 mg or less) doesn't make much sense because you'll end up having to use a quarter of the bottle for each dose.
